[发明专利]用于嵌入式系统的差分升级方法有效
申请号: | 201210176729.5 | 申请日: | 2012-05-31 |
公开(公告)号: | CN102693145A | 公开(公告)日: | 2012-09-26 |
发明(设计)人: | 温长会 | 申请(专利权)人: | 红石阳光(北京)科技有限公司 |
主分类号: | G06F9/445 | 分类号: | G06F9/445 |
代理公司: | 北京汲智翼成知识产权代理事务所(普通合伙) 11381 | 代理人: | 陈曦;郭亚芳 |
地址: | 100086 北京市海*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| 本发明公开了一种用于嵌入式系统的差分升级方法,包括如下步骤:⑴根据备份空间大小确定每步升级的备份数据和目标数据大小;⑵基于原始版本数据和差分数据生成新版本软件的目标数据,写入嵌入式系统的内存空间中;将存储空间的部分原始版本数据复制至备份空间,作为备份数据;⑶将目标数据写入存储空间的目标区域;⑷针对存储空间中的其它原始版本数据,重复步骤⑵~⑶,直至所有的原始版本数据被新版本软件的目标数据替代。利用本发明所提供的方法,在嵌入式系统的软件升级过程中可以减小占用的备份空间,同时减小占用的内存空间。 | ||
搜索关键词: | 用于 嵌入式 系统 升级 方法 | ||
【主权项】:
一种用于嵌入式系统的差分升级方法,其特征在于包括如下步骤:(1)根据备份空间大小确定每步升级的备份数据和目标数据大小;⑵基于原始版本数据和差分数据生成新版本软件的目标数据,写入嵌入式系统的内存空间中;将存储空间的部分原始版本数据复制至备份空间,作为所述备份数据;⑶将所述目标数据写入存储空间的目标区域;⑷针对存储空间中的其它原始版本数据,重复步骤⑵~⑶,直至所有的原始版本数据被新版本软件的目标数据替代。
下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于红石阳光(北京)科技有限公司,未经红石阳光(北京)科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/patent/201210176729.5/,转载请声明来源钻瓜专利网。